Sources in Lincoln County, Colorado that EPA records under the synthetic minor source classification. The classification is a size band, set by a source’s potential to emit: a major source is large enough to require a Title V operating permit, a synthetic minor source has accepted enforceable limits that keep it under that threshold, and a minor source sits below it without needing them.
